Biography
Kate Walker was born the spring of 1950 in Nottinghamshire, England, but the family moved to West Yorkshire when she was just 18 months old. She was the middle child of five daughters.
She studied English and Library Science in the University College of Wales, Aberystwyth, where she met her husband. They married and installed in Lincolnshire She worked until she was a mother.
Kate Walker published her first novel in 1984.
